Farewell and welcome at the AGM

Steve Northeast and Sue Choularton would like to thank everyone who welcomed them so warmly to their respective captaincy years after their election during Saturday's AGM.

While the formalities of the event will be recorded in the minutes, it was great to see so many people support outgoing captains Lorna Dolinska and Ian Larter as well as give their backing to the new captains.

The day started with a shotgun start and nearly 100 golfers competing in the annual Trophy Winners' Trophy competition. Winner Andrew Coom, who scored an impressive 43pts, was presented with his trophy during the AGM. He was two shots ahead of Jane Northeast's 40pts.

Steve and Sue's first event is a Texas Scramble, another 9am shotgun start, on Sunday November 6. You can sign up via the Pro Shop, if you have trouble using Club V1. There's prizes to the winning teams, followed by the Captains' Drive In and then a curry (you must opt-out of the food if you can't stay to eat). Please support your new captains if you can.

Duo win final ladies' trophies of 2022 season

The final two ladies' trophies of the season have been presented to Camilla Mott and Jane Van Egmond by outgoing Lady Captain Lorna Dolinska.

Following another fantastic season, Camilla Mott was awarded the Lady Golfer of the Year trophy during Saturday's AGM. After the meeting formalities, Lorna handed Camilla a keepsake trophy and there was also a trophy for Jane Van Egmond to take home. 

Jane won the most Improved Lady Golfer of the season, after her WHS Index was cut by more than six shots during the course of the year.

Vets gain revenge over Roehampton

The Vets gained revenge for two losses earlier in the season at home v Roehampton with a very impressive away win at Roehampton 5½ - ½.

Vets Masters Trophy

Congratulations to Ken Bridgeman on winning the recently revived Vets Masters, with Roger Rushton a very close 2nd and Steve Northeast 3rd.

Everyone's a winner at the race night!

More than 40 members and guests had a great evening at a Charity Race Night, organised by Ken Bridgeman. The event raised £1,446 for the captain's charity, including a generous donation from the club owners. Thanks to everyone for their support, including those who helped make it such a success.

Jack and Ronan packing their bags for Portugal!

An impressive 45pts in the Titleist FootJoy Matchplay Regional Final at Pyrford Lakes has seen Jack Law and Ronan McDermott win a place at the prestigious Grand Final in Portugal in January.

Jack and Ronan were second on countback to a duo from Crowborough Beacon, who also scored 45pts. But the top four pairs all qualified for a place at Vale do Lobo Golf & Beach Resort on the Algarve. 

They will play a practice round and three competitive rounds on the Ocean and Royal Courses from January 3-7, competing against 43 other pairs for the Titleist FootJoy Matchplay Championship title. Good luck to Jack and Ronan!

Ladies' World Cup Match

The ladies' annual World Cup fixture saw a seven-strong England team take on seven players representing the Rest of the World in an aggregate Stableford match.

England retained the trophy, with an impressive Stableford total of 219pts against the 182pts scored by the Rest of the World. The leading scorer was England team member Jenny Tracey, with 38pts.
